Output 729727568d1c8ab32e07770459207b8a2ea4a453b4f1af39ba30fff21ccc3385:1

value
101889999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ca575b00756971ef1995989c30e345012033296 OP_EQUAL
address
3EWgjk2jNc8Jqwu4JZPkLu6sot4CxCHRxR
transaction
729727568d1c8ab32e07770459207b8a2ea4a453b4f1af39ba30fff21ccc3385
spent
true